What is an Air Duct Cleaning Company?

Cleaning the air ducts is a necessary cleaning service, especially for households. Air duct cleaning is the process of cleaning your air ducts and the entire duct system, including the supply, intake, and return vents, with expert air duct cleaning equipment. Cleaning the registers, grilles, fans, HVAC unit, and, if applicable, the furnace is also part of air duct cleaning.

Professional duct cleaning equipment is sold by air duct cleaning firms, and it is designed to clean your air ducts and make them a healthier living environment in your home. It is advised that you get your air ducts cleaned every three to five years, while in some circumstances, two to three years would be the most significant time for the best results and efficiency.

If not properly installed, maintained, and operated, these components may become contaminated with dust, pollen, or other materials. When moisture is present, the chance of microbiological growth increases, and spores from such growth may be released into the living environment. Some of these toxins may cause allergic reactions or other symptoms in those who are exposed to them.

Air duct cleaning companies have various service methods, including source removal, steam air duct cleaning, truck-mounted vacuum cleaning, and point-of-contact cleaning.

The most popular and highly recommended way of cleaning air ducts is source removal. This mechanically cleans your system by removing dirt and particles that have built up over time. This method of elimination contains two essential elements: mechanical agitation and extraction. These particles tend to statically cling or attach to the inside of your air ducts.

Steam air duct cleaning uses a wand to stir and dislodge particles, grime, and debris clinging to your vent walls by releasing high-pressure, high-temperature steam into the duct system.

The truck-mounted vacuum cleaning method connects the trunk lines of the vent system to a vacuum from the truck. This line draws between 10,000 and 15,000 cubic feet of air per minute. Rotary brushes are put into air vents to help loosen and transport waste to the collection location.

Point-of-contact cleaning, by far the safest and most successful cleaning approach to date, employs a portable vacuum with a HEPA filter along with an agitating device are used to clean the air ducts. The HEPA filter is essential in the cleaning process because it decreases cross-contamination.

Air Duct Cleaning Companies to Avoid

There are a lot of air duct cleaning firms out there that will take your money and give you poor service. Here are a few things to check for in order to avoid inadequate services.

  • Certifications. NADCA certification is required for a reliable duct cleaning firm. Unfortunately, some companies falsely claim to be NADCA certified.   • Suspicious Discounts and Promotions. Don’t be fooled by a firm that gives you air duct cleaning pricing that is too good to be true. At best, you’ll get a perfunctory cleaning of a few vents at a bargain price, and at worst, they’ll try to persuade you into a more expensive cleaning package that may contain services you don’t require. This tactic is referred to as “blow and go” in the industry. Be on the watch for these scams and be aware that higher-quality services and firms are available to complete the task.
